> Um, it's quite annoying to be constantly interrupted to interact > various programs during the configuration phase of a Debian install. It's the Mother of All FAQs and has been discussed (but not solved) an incredible number of times. > If it's an absolute requirement for configuration scripts to be able > to ask questions, then perhaps there could be two categories, ones > which never ask questions and all the others. Run the non-interactive Many other suggestions have been made to solve the problem. It is not easy. You have to find: - a good scheme (think of X11-only installers, without a tty), - implement it (i.e. modify 3000 packages' {pre,post}{rm,inst}.
